Transaction 86e77166e39acb2540aa5f1b2a6ce605c5aa57c86fced913348d76b91e1c97d5
1 Input
1 Output
-
86e77166e39acb2540aa5f1b2a6ce605c5aa57c86fced913348d76b91e1c97d5:0
- value
- 4354915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a7afa3de1def69112386955ebd99bf624f09ab4 OP_EQUAL
- address
- 3QXSB8PwQeg3nSCUym6TEvpfgXvDHLAo7o